Gaurav Gera (born 23 September 1973) is an Indian comedian and actor who works in Hindi language films and television series.[3] He also worked in Bollywood musical Jhumroo.[4][5][6] He is well known for playing the role of Nandu in Jassi Jaisi Koi Nahin.[7][8][9] Gaurav has been granted exclusive Snapchat filters on multiple occasions to meet up with his fans’ demands.[10]

Career[edit]

Television[edit]

Gera started his career with Life Nahin Hai Laddoo on Star Plus and then he played the supporting role as Nandu in Sony TV's show Jassi Jaisi Koi Nahin.[11] He also appeared in various shows, Kohi Apna Sa, Baat Hamari Pakki Hai, Babban Bhai v/s Bimla Tai.[12] He also played the lead role in Sab TV's show Tota Weds Maina[13] and Colors TV show Mrs. Pammi Pyarelal.[14][15] He was last seen in Colors TV's reality show Comedy Nights with Kapil as Dulari.[16][17][18][19] In 2016, he made a cameo in the series Naagin as Chutki. He was also a participant on Jhalak Dikhhla Jaa. In 2019 he appeared in the Alt Balaji show Boss - Baap of Special Services where he essayed the role of Jignesh.[20]

Films[edit]

Gera made his Bollywood debut with the Hindi movie Kyun...! Ho Gaya Na, where he played a cameo role.[21] In 2008, he played Vinay Pathak's younger brother Vivek in Dasvidaniya.[22] He also gave cameo appearances in Chalo Dilli, Woodstock Villa, MP3: Mera Pehla Pehla Pyaar[23] In 2015, he starred in MSG: The Messenger as Bhondu.[24]

Other media[edit]

Gera is known for a range of characters he essays on his Snapchat and Instagram handles, these include the widely popular Shopkeeper, Chutki, Billi Massi among others.[25][26][27]
